You can sign up online to speak at council meetings in person or via Zoom online at this link up to 15 minutes before the scheduled meeting, which is typically at the 7:00 Regular Meeting. You may alternatively share your thoughts by emailing the council members any time at our email addresses here, or by 4:00 PM the day of the meeting at councilcomments@plano.gov. The council meeting will be live-streamed on PlanoTV.org and on the City of Plano Facebook page.

Comments of Public Interest: anyone can speak for up to three minutes, with 30 total minutes allotted for this segment.

 

Items for Individual Consideration

  • Item (1): Request to table an appeal of the Planning & Zoning Commission’s denial of a rezoning request for 6.6 acres southwest of K Avenue and Spring Creek Parkway from Corridor Commercial to Single-Family Residence Attached for 49 Single-Family Attached units
  • Item (2): Grant a Specific Use Permit (SUP) for Trade School for barbers, cosmetologists, estheticians, manicurists, and other similar beauty school trades on 0.1 acres southeast of Dexter Drive and Preston Road
  • Item (3): Transfer $1,200,000 from the Convention & Tourism Fund to the Capital Maintenance Fund for fiscal year 2024-25 to replace two generators at the Plano Event Center
  • Item (4): Presentation on the FY 2024-25 Status Report and 5-Year Financial Summary

 

Notable Consent Agenda Items

Total of $5,619,432 of your money in proposed expenses

  • Item (b): $1,806,667 for a five-year subscription and three years of hardware/software maintenance support and management services for 9-1-1 Call Processing and Call Handling Equipment (CPE) and Call Handling Equipment (CHE)
  • Item (d): $2,004,115 for the High Point Park North Restroom Building Replacement
  • Item (k): to approve a DECREASE (yes, it happens more than you might think) of $192,473 to the current contract amount of $3,012,243 for Intersection Improvements Parker Road Corridor at Coit Road and Alma Drive
  • Item (m): to adopt increased user fees for City Ambulance Services, with insurers as the primary source of additional revenues
